Pharmacies preparing to vaccinate 12 to 15-year-olds

WESH2

OSCEOLA COUNTY, Fla. — Pharmacies like Prescriptions Unlimited in St. Cloud are still working on giving out second doses to those 16-and-up. Meanwhile, they tell us they’ve already received more than a hundred requests for vaccines in the next category: 12 through 15.

“We’ve already gotten a ton of requests and emails last night, especially from the parents that have 16-and-up, they also have children that are 12-and-up so they’re already asking when we’ll have that available,” owner and pharmacist at Prescriptions Unlimited, Eric Larson, said.

Advertisement
Larson says he’s teamed up with the Osceola County School District and department of health to vaccinate teens at their pharmacy or at one of their pop-up locations.

This Saturday, those will be Celebration and Liberty High Schools.

There’s one more step before he can offer the shots to the new age group.

“What we have to do is get the language to update our forms, our intake forms, and make sure everything is kosher with the state and local department of health,” Larson said.

Larson says he’s expecting turn out to be about the same as when the 16 to 18 population became eligible which was about 800 to a thousand kids.

As far as adults go, Larson says they’ve seen a significant decline, but they’re still doing about 40 to 50 shots a day.
